Free app. Fantastic interface. Easy-to-use controls. Endless combinations. Everything about the Drummer app from Keezy is phenomenal, including the $0 price tag. Developed by Pasquale D’Silva (The guy that built the app Keezy that Reggie Watts beatboxed on.) and Jake Lodwick (Co-founder of Vimeo.), Drummer is the simplest drum machine app we’ve ever played with. It’s not going to replace anything of a more “professional” grade, but that’s not the point. The free app makes manning the controls of a drum machine easy, accessible and fun. You get up to nine different slots for every from kicks and snares, to claps, clicks and snaps. We’re not drummers. We’re not even professional musicians. We designed something in approximately fifteen seconds that we’ve been listening to on repeat for the last twenty minutes, and we don’t absolutely hate it. In other words, anyone can use it.
